Output dd2e58f3826a1237e722d02edebf08ea74a5d5667b74cd70c166e817bf39afee:0

value
94851
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f38fed17e3766cca7cd3816ab90054b4183440cf OP_EQUAL
address
3PtrYKf313mirg5Kvb4BpTvRBMaXWcCeEY
transaction
dd2e58f3826a1237e722d02edebf08ea74a5d5667b74cd70c166e817bf39afee
confirmations
113935
spent
true